Light-Handed is a modification held by the Atlantis Georgias that causes held Items to have a negative eDensity.

Effect

Light-Handed is a modification that causes items held by a player to have a negative eDensity, reducing a team and player's overall eDesnity.

Notably a Light-Handed player who becomes Negative has this effect reversed, where being Light-Handed actually increases their eDensity.

History

In the Season 20 Election Light-Handed appeared as an available blessing and was won by the Atlantis Georgias. This blessing was used to great effect to manipulate the eDesnity of the team by taking advantage of the Gift Shop and Item Move Will in Season 21. Details can be found on the page for eDensity.
